Understanding Fuel Efficiency: The Basics

Before diving into specific strategies, let's understand the fundamental factors influencing fuel efficiency. Your vehicle's fuel economy is primarily determined by three key elements:

  • Engine size and type: Larger engines generally consume more fuel than smaller ones. The type of engine (gasoline, diesel, hybrid, electric) also significantly impacts fuel efficiency. Hybrid and electric vehicles, for example, offer superior fuel economy compared to traditional gasoline-powered vehicles.

  • Vehicle weight: Heavier vehicles require more energy to accelerate and maintain speed, leading to higher fuel consumption. Carrying unnecessary weight, such as extra cargo or passengers, also affects fuel economy.

  • Driving style: This is arguably the most controllable factor. Aggressive driving habits like hard acceleration, rapid braking, and excessive speeding dramatically increase fuel consumption. Smooth, consistent driving is key to maximizing fuel efficiency.

Practical Steps to Save Fuel: A Step-by-Step Guide

Now let's move on to practical steps you can take to reduce your fuel consumption. These are categorized for clarity and easy implementation:

1. Optimize Your Driving Habits

This is often the easiest and most effective way to improve fuel economy. Consider these changes:

  • Maintain a consistent speed: Avoid sudden acceleration and braking. Smooth, gradual acceleration and deceleration conserve more fuel. Cruising at a steady speed on the highway is more fuel-efficient than constantly accelerating and decelerating.

  • Anticipate traffic: Observe traffic conditions ahead and adjust your speed accordingly. This helps avoid unnecessary braking and acceleration, contributing to smoother driving and better fuel efficiency.

  • Avoid idling: Turn off your engine if you're stopped for more than a minute. Idling consumes fuel without moving your vehicle. This is particularly important in traffic jams or during long waits.

  • Use cruise control: On long highway drives, cruise control can help maintain a consistent speed, reducing fuel consumption. That said, be mindful of its limitations; it's less effective in varying terrain or traffic conditions.

  • Plan your routes: Choose routes that minimize stops and traffic congestion. Using GPS navigation can help you find the most efficient route.

  • Avoid unnecessary weight: Remove any unnecessary items from your vehicle. Even small amounts of extra weight can impact fuel economy.

2. Maintain Your Vehicle Properly

Regular vehicle maintenance is crucial for optimal fuel efficiency. These steps are vital:

  • Tire pressure: Under-inflated tires increase rolling resistance, leading to higher fuel consumption. Check your tire pressure regularly and inflate them to the recommended pressure specified in your vehicle's owner's manual.

  • Wheel alignment: Improper wheel alignment can also increase rolling resistance and reduce fuel efficiency. Get your wheels aligned regularly by a professional mechanic.

  • Engine tune-up: Ensure your engine is properly tuned. A poorly tuned engine burns more fuel than a well-maintained one. Regular servicing, including spark plug replacement and air filter cleaning, is vital.

  • Regular oil changes: Using the correct type and grade of oil, as recommended by your vehicle manufacturer, is crucial for engine efficiency and fuel economy. Regular oil changes prevent engine wear and maintain optimal performance.

  • Air filter maintenance: A clogged air filter restricts airflow to the engine, reducing its efficiency and increasing fuel consumption. Replace or clean your air filter regularly according to your vehicle's maintenance schedule.

3. Consider Technological Advancements

Several technological advancements can boost fuel efficiency:

  • Hybrid vehicles: Hybrid vehicles combine a gasoline engine with an electric motor, offering significantly improved fuel economy compared to traditional gasoline-powered vehicles. They're particularly efficient in stop-and-go traffic.

  • Electric vehicles: Electric vehicles (EVs) are powered entirely by electricity, eliminating gasoline consumption altogether. That said, their range is limited by battery capacity and charging infrastructure availability.

  • Fuel-efficient tires: Certain tire designs are engineered to reduce rolling resistance, leading to improved fuel economy. Look for tires with low rolling resistance ratings.

  • Aerodynamic modifications: While some modifications might be costly, aerodynamic improvements to your vehicle, such as installing a spoiler or underbody panels, can reduce wind resistance and improve fuel economy.

4. Fuel-Saving Driving Techniques: Advanced Strategies

Beyond the basic driving tips, there are more advanced techniques you can employ:

  • Eco-driving techniques: This involves a conscious effort to drive smoothly and efficiently. This includes anticipating traffic flow, coasting when appropriate, and using engine braking on downhill slopes to reduce reliance on the brakes.

  • Hypermiling: This involves extreme fuel-saving techniques, often pushing the boundaries of safe driving. While some techniques might yield significant fuel savings, others are risky and not recommended for everyday driving.

  • Regenerative braking: In hybrid and electric vehicles, regenerative braking captures kinetic energy during braking and converts it into electricity, recharging the battery and improving overall efficiency.

The Science Behind Fuel Efficiency

Fuel efficiency is governed by the laws of physics. The energy required to move a vehicle is influenced by several factors:

  • Rolling resistance: This is the friction between the tires and the road surface. Proper tire inflation and wheel alignment minimize rolling resistance.

  • Aerodynamic drag: This is the resistance of air against the vehicle as it moves. Aerodynamic design is key here in minimizing drag.

  • Inertia: This is the tendency of an object to resist changes in its motion. Smooth acceleration and deceleration minimize the energy needed to overcome inertia.

  • Engine efficiency: The efficiency of the engine itself in converting fuel into mechanical energy affects fuel consumption. Regular maintenance and modern engine designs contribute to increased efficiency.

Frequently Asked Questions (FAQ)

Q: Does using air conditioning significantly impact fuel economy?

A: Yes, using air conditioning can reduce fuel efficiency, especially in older vehicles. Still, modern vehicles have more efficient air conditioning systems that minimize the impact. Consider using it sparingly, especially at lower speeds.

Q: What is the best fuel type for fuel efficiency?

A: Generally, diesel fuel offers slightly better fuel economy than gasoline. Even so, the fuel economy of a vehicle also depends on its engine design and other factors. Hybrid and electric vehicles offer the best fuel efficiency.

Q: How often should I check my tire pressure?

A: It's recommended to check your tire pressure at least once a month, and before long trips. Check the pressure when the tires are cold (haven't been driven recently).

Q: Can I improve fuel economy by using fuel additives?

A: Some fuel additives claim to improve fuel economy, but their effectiveness varies. It's best to stick to using high-quality fuel and properly maintaining your vehicle.

Q: What is the role of weight distribution in fuel efficiency?

A: Even weight distribution helps optimize handling and reduce strain on the vehicle's components, leading to slightly better fuel economy.
